I just picked up my first Cummins. 1996 Cummins 12 Valve with 233k Miles. Mechanically sound Body is hell. But i bought a southern 96 1500 for the body im about 7grand into this project, Well i was driving the cummins home from work today, Stopped at a light took off fine got to about 45-50Mph It didnt feel like the trans slipped, Felt more like it just changed gears my rpms went a high, More so it felt like i hit the OD button the dash then it went back to normal and my rpms went back down, It did this twice in a row then was fine for the rest of the 25min drive home. I even messed with it driving, Shifting it in and out slow speed high speed, I got on it hard. I know these 12v's dont have much Nut off the line. i just dont want to put all this work into changing the bodys over and have my tranny go.

That happens to my truck a few times a year. For some reason it shifts out of OD on it's own, just like if I pushed the OD button. I've heard it happen to other people too. Personally I don't think it's a trans problem, I think it's a sensor or wiring problem.

I have a'96 I bought from my father a few years ago. Only recently did I begin driving it every day. I have noticed the trans shifts weird when it's cold outside. Mine goes into OD just above 45 mph. When it's really cold, it'll go into OD, but the least amount of throttle will pop it back out, like on a very gentle incline. I googled the issue, and some said there is a sensor in the trans pan that will start to act up over time and can be the culprit.

It might be the wires going up the steering column for the shifter button that are broke.. Mine busted right underneath the plastic cover by the dash.. I resolved it with a horn button on the dash insted of trying to piece them tiny 2 wires back together ..
